MORETON Rangers made it three Gloucestershire Northern Senior League Division One games unbeaten with a 3-0 home win over Newent Town.
Lee Brooks, Robert Hands and Martin Tomes scored for Rangers, who visit top-half rivals Cam Bulldogs on Saturday (2pm).
Struggling Winchcombe Town lost 2-1 at home to Smiths Athletic in Division Two and head to Chalford on Saturday (2pm).
Chipping Norton beat Charlbury 4-1 in the Witney and District League Premier Division.
Warwick Tompkins (2), Kieran Watts and Andy McCabe scored.
Title-chasing Bourton Rovers drew 2-2 at Combe in Division One with Josh Catling and Sam Mattock on target.
They visit Brockworth Albion in the Gloucestershire FA Senior Amateur Cup third round on Saturday.
